The elimination of the 30% residential Investment Tax Credit marks the most visible impact among solar changes 2026. Following the passage of the One Big Beautiful Bill, homeowners who installed systems before December 31, 2025, were the last to claim the direct consumer tax credit. Consequently, residential demand dropped by an estimated 25% in early 2026, creating immediate challenges for installers focused on the residential market.

Nevertheless, the picture isn’t entirely bleak. Third-party ownership arrangements—leases and Power Purchase Agreements—remain eligible for the 48E tax credit through 2027. This means installers who pivot toward offering prepaid leases and PPAs can still provide customers with federal incentive value. Moreover, these financing structures are becoming increasingly attractive as they absorb the complexity of FEOC compliance on behalf of homeowners.

Understanding FEOC Requirements for Solar Installers

Starting January 1, 2026, Foreign Entity of Concern regulations fundamentally altered the commercial solar landscape. These requirements restrict projects from receiving federal tax credits if they use excessive components from prohibited foreign entities—primarily China, Russia, Iran, and North Korea. For solar projects beginning construction in 2026, at least 40% of manufactured products must come from non-PFE sources.

Furthermore, this threshold increases by 5 percentage points annually, reaching 60% for projects starting after 2029. Solar installers and EPCs must now verify their supply chains, obtain manufacturer certifications, and calculate material assistance cost ratios. While this adds complexity, it also creates competitive advantages for companies that establish FEOC-compliant supply chains early.

Supply Chain Shifts Affecting Solar Projects

The solar changes 2026 are forcing dramatic supply chain reorganization. Module imports from Cambodia dropped to zero in early 2025, while imports from traditional Southeast Asian sources decreased significantly. Meanwhile, Indonesia and Laos captured 34.6% of the U.S. module import market by Q1 2025. Additionally, manufacturers are rapidly developing “reliance letters” certifying their FEOC compliance status.

Smart installers are proactively auditing their supplier networks and establishing relationships with FEOC-compliant manufacturers. This preparation not only ensures project eligibility but also protects against future supply disruptions. In addition, projects that achieved safe harbor status before December 31, 2025, remain protected from these requirements for up to four years.

Pricing and Cost Considerations

Solar pricing in 2026 faces competing pressures. On one hand, FEOC-compliant components command premium prices due to supply-demand imbalances. Projects requiring domestically manufactured or certified non-PFE equipment see costs rising monthly through the first half of 2026. On the other hand, Federal Reserve interest rate reductions are making solar loans more affordable—each 1% rate decrease effectively reduces project costs by approximately $0.15 per watt.

Additionally, long-term solar technology costs continue their downward trajectory. Industry leaders target $2 per watt within 5-10 years, and advanced technologies like TOPCon panels and tandem perovskite cells are entering the market. Installers balancing immediate cost pressures with long-term efficiency gains position themselves advantageously.

Technical Advances Driving Solar Forward

Despite policy challenges, solar technology leaps forward in 2026. TOPCon technology is capturing 70% of the market, offering 24% efficiency and superior hot-weather performance. These advanced panels maintain output better over time, providing better long-term value for clients. Furthermore, back-contact designs eliminate front-facing wiring, improving both aesthetics and performance.

Smart inverters and advanced monitoring systems are making installations more grid-friendly while providing clients with unprecedented control and visibility. For installers and EPCs, offering cutting-edge technology demonstrates value beyond just cost considerations. Consequently, technical expertise becomes a key differentiator in competitive markets.

Storage Integration and Grid Services

Energy storage integration has transitioned from optional to essential for many installations. Battery capacity grew 45% in 2025, and this trajectory continues through 2026. Commercial clients increasingly request solar-plus-storage systems for backup power, demand charge management, and grid services participation. Installers developing storage expertise and installation capabilities open multiple revenue streams.

Moreover, utility-scale projects focusing on grid integration and bulk generation remain strong despite temporary global market slowdowns. The U.S. solar capacity is projected to reach 182 gigawatts by year-end 2026, with utilities providing most new electricity generation capacity. EPCs with utility-scale experience find robust project pipelines despite broader market uncertainties.
